These Carhartt Duck Bib Overalls are an updated version of the popular R01 Bibs. The Carhartt design team solicited feedback from real-life workers who provided suggestions on enhancements. Every detail, from the front-to-back kick panel on the cuffs to the extra stretch around the waist, was informed by the hardworking people who wear Carhartt gear day-in and out. Constructed using heavyweight, durable cotton duck that handles hard work like a champ.

Stunned and disappointed at how much these coveralls shrunk after 1 wash and dry. I'm not sure if it's the stretchy suspender straps or the pant fabric itself but these have shrunk beyond wearability after first time wearing. They say on the sticker to buy your pant size which I did and when I tried them on they fit nicely with the straps adjusted with about 5inches of play left in the straps. After 1 wash they are so small that even with the suspenders let all the way out the legs barely reach my ankles. I thought I was buying higher quality by purchasing carhartts over the usual Dakotas instead I paid a premium for single use.

I suspect these Carhartt overalls are factory seconds. The front pockets are so shallow they are unusable. When my hands are inserted into the pockets they bottom out with my pointing finger barely covered and I have small hands. Nothing can be safely carried in these pockets without the very real possibility of losing the item. I have other Carhartt overalls including an insulated version and the pockets are much deeper and completely useable. Could be I was unlucky and received a one off defective pair of overalls but I doubt it. Other than the issue with the pockets they appear to be genuine Carhartt overalls with the same rugged construction you expect from Carhartt. These are pretty similar to my previous Carhartt overalls, except for the design of the pockets. I can tolerate the different chest pockets, and ignore the dumb chest pocket zipper. But the front side pockets are utterly useless because they're so shallow. The side cutout is more vertical, and deeper. Overalls are for crawling under trucks and similar uses, but your keys, and everything else, WILL fall out. The pockets completely ruin the usefulness of the entire overalls.
